Collections

David Alfred Vaughan
Grim Precisioncirca 1940

Not on view
Oil painting of two helmeted figures holding binoculars, peering over a dark ledge, rendered in geometric forms in copper, olive green, and salmon tones
Oil painting, close-up of a figure holding black binoculars with teal-tinted lenses up to their face, rendered in simplified, semi-abstract forms with muted brown, gray, and green tones and visible brushwork.
Oil painting, close-up view of a figure holding dark binoculars up to their face, the lenses rendered in deep grey-green against warm flesh tones, with broad expressive brushwork and muted grey-green background.
Artist or Maker
David Alfred Vaughan
United States, 1893-1975
Title
Grim Precision
Date Made
circa 1940
Medium
Oil on Masonite
Dimensions
25 3/4 x 27 3/4 in. (65.41 x 70.49 cm)
Credit Line
Gift of David and Linda Vaughan
Accession Number
M.2011.176
Classification
Paintings
Collecting Area
American Art
